  1. "The Kentucky Derby Is Decadent and Depraved" is a seminal sports article written by journalist Hunter S. Thompson on the 1970 Kentucky Derby, which first appeared in Scanlan's Monthly in June of that year. The article marked the birth of what would become known as "gonzo journalism". History.
